Firewall
Zoraxy plugin — Inline WAF inspection proxy with health checks, circuit breaker, and fail-open bypass. Works with Wallarm, ModSecurity, Coraza, or any inspection service that returns HTTP status codes.
Quick Install
The plugin is built into Zoraxy — just enable it from the Plugins panel. If you need to build from source:
git clone https://git.lohmar.co.uk/cclohmar/zoraxy-waf.git /opt/zoraxy/plugins/zoraxy-waf
cd /opt/zoraxy/plugins/zoraxy-waf
go build -buildvcs=false -o zoraxy-waf .
chown -R zoraxy:zoraxy /opt/zoraxy/plugins/zoraxy-waf
systemctl restart zoraxy
Then enable Firewall in Zoraxy → Plugins.

How It Works
Client → Zoraxy → Plugin → http://waf:8080 [Firewall App] → inspect
│
┌────┴──────────┐
│ 403 → BLOCK │
│ 2xx → RETURN │──→ Zoraxy (port 8080) → Backend
│ down → FAIL-OPEN│──→ Zoraxy routes directly
└───────────────┘
- Zoraxy proxies traffic to the firewall application at the configured WAF URL
- The firewall app inspects the request inline
- If blocked (403), the plugin drops the request
- If allowed (2xx), traffic returns to Zoraxy on the return port for routing to the final backend
- If the firewall app is unreachable, the circuit breaker opens and traffic bypasses inspection (fail-open)
Circuit Breaker
If the WAF fails 5 times within a 30-second window, the breaker opens. All traffic bypasses inspection (fail-open) for 10 seconds. After the cooldown, the next successful health check closes the breaker.
Health Check
The plugin periodically sends a HEAD request to the WAF URL. If the firewall application responds, the circuit breaker records success. If unreachable, it records a failure.
Inspection Protocol
The plugin proxies the full HTTP request to the WAF URL. The firewall application inspects it inline and returns an HTTP status code:
- 200–299 → Traffic is clean, returned to Zoraxy for routing
- 403 → Request is malicious, plugin blocks it
- 5xx / timeout → Plugin fails open, breaker records failure
Any firewall application that accepts proxied HTTP traffic and returns a status code is compatible.
Zoraxy Integration
To activate the plugin for specific proxy rules:
- Zoraxy → Plugins → enable Firewall
- Create a plugin group (e.g., "waf") → add the Firewall plugin
- Edit proxy rules → add the "waf" tag
The plugin uses Zoraxy's static capture to intercept all requests matched by tagged proxy rules.
